Diamantensemblet  

ensemble

DiamantEnsemblet is the Royal Danish Library’s own ensemble and is based in the Queen’s Hall in the ‘Black Diamond’ building on the Copenhagen waterfront. The ensemble is headed by the solo oboist of the Danish National Symphony Orchestra/DR Max Artved and consists of ten musicians.

The ensemble became a reality in 2004 with Siemens is its principal sponsor and DR as its media partner, and as such is the only ensemble of its kind in Denmark. Every year the ensemble plays six concerts in the Black Diamond; in addition DiamantEnsemblet has visited a few exclusive venues around Denmark.

DiamantEnsemblet has played with a number of star artists including András Schiff, Leif Ove Andsnes and Olli Mustonen. In 2005 the ensemble released its first CD on the Naxos label with music by among others Dvorák, and with Naxos it is also responsible for an international CD release of music by Ludvig Spohr. In the spring of 2007 DiamantEnsemblet was on an international tour with concerts at the Heidelberg Festival and at the Wigmore Hall in London.
